Output 5266ba3948a318f02c554752208087700179b0101c74d7e3f2b2a613dc3680ee:3

value
41456905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c017b0851a22a7ca7bf42a7634bef72984ba1594 OP_EQUAL
address
MRQrMEpaJjWV4y4uXLogcxAksHJHV1Mnec
transaction
5266ba3948a318f02c554752208087700179b0101c74d7e3f2b2a613dc3680ee
spent
true